VEGAN WAFFLES



Vegan Waffles image

These vegan waffles are the BEST! Golden and crispy on the outside, tender and fluffy on the inside. They're also super easy to make using pantry staples. Serve with loads of syrup and fresh fruit for the best vegan breakfast.

Provided by Alison Andrews

Categories     Breakfast     Dessert

Time 30m

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 1/4 cup All Purpose Flour ((156g))
3 Tbsp White Granulated Sugar
2 tsp Baking Powder
1/4 tsp Salt
1 1/4 cup Soy Milk ((300ml) or other non-dairy milk)
2 Tbsp Coconut Oil (Melted)
2 tsp Vanilla Extract

Steps:

  • Set your waffle iron to preheat while you mix the batter.
  • Sift all purpose flour into a mixing bowl and add sugar, baking powder and salt. Mix together.
  • Add soy milk, melted coconut oil and vanilla extract and mix into a batter. Don't overmix.
  • When your waffle maker is heated, grease the waffle iron or spray it with non-stick spray (see notes). Pour even amounts of batter into the waffle machine and close the machine.
  • Cook for 3-5 minutes or until golden.
  • Serve with vegan butter, powdered sugar and fresh berries with loads of syrup drizzled over the top.

Nutrition Facts : ServingSize 1 Waffle, Calories 139 kcal, Sugar 6 g, Sodium 198 mg, Fat 4 g, SaturatedFat 3 g, Carbohydrate 21 g, Fiber 1 g, Protein 3 g, UnsaturatedFat 2 g

COCONUT MILK WAFFLES [OIL FREE]



Coconut Milk Waffles [Oil Free] image

Coconut milk waffles are CRISPY on the outside, but soft and fluffy in the middle.

Provided by Rosa

Categories     Breakfast

Time 25m

Number Of Ingredients 9

270 grams whole wheat flour (approx. 2 cups spooned + leveled)
2 teaspoons baking powder
400 ml Thai Kitchen unsweetened coconut milk (approx. 13.5 ounce can)
1/3 cup mashed banana (approx. 1 very small banana or half a large)
1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
2-4 tablespoons water (if needed)
blueberry chia jam
fresh fruit
maple syrup

Steps:

  • Preheat your waffle iron to medium-high heat.
  • In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the flour and baking powder. Then add the coconut milk, banana, and vanilla and mix until just combined, and no floury bits remain but don't overmix. A few lumps are perfectly fine.NOTE: If the batter appears too thick (it should be pourable similar to pancake batter), add the optional water and give everything another quick stir.
  • Cook the waffles according to the manufacturer's instructions, approx 5-6 minutes for each batch. Cook longer for crispier waffles, and less for softer waffles.
  • Serve with blueberry chia jam, maple syrup, or fresh fruit.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 160 kcal, Carbohydrate 22 g, Protein 4 g, Fat 7 g, SaturatedFat 6 g, Sodium 101 mg, Fiber 3 g, Sugar 2 g, ServingSize 1 serving

VEGAN WAFFLES



Vegan Waffles image

These waffles are so yummy it feels sinful eating them. Even my husband and 3-year-old who don't share my vegan eating habits loved them! You can use rice milk instead of soy.

Provided by Anonymous

Categories     Breakfast and Brunch     Waffle Recipes

Time 40m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 11

6 tablespoons water
2 tablespoons flax seed meal
1 cup rolled oats
1 ¾ cups soy milk
½ cup all-purpose flour
½ cup whole wheat flour
2 tablespoons canola oil
4 teaspoons baking powder
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 tablespoon agave nectar
½ teaspoon salt

Steps:

  • Preheat a waffle iron according to manufacturer's instructions.
  • Stir water and flax seed meal together in a bowl.
  • Blend oats in a blender into a flour-like consistency. Add flax seed mixture, soy milk, all-purpose flour, whole wheat flour, canola oil, baking powder, vanilla extract, agave nectar, and salt to oats; blend until batter is just mixed.
  • Ladle 1/2 cup batter into preheated waffle iron. Cook the waffles according to manufacturer's instructions until golden and crisp, about 5 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 228.7 calories, Carbohydrate 33.1 g, Fat 8.1 g, Fiber 4.1 g, Protein 7 g, SaturatedFat 0.8 g, Sodium 557.7 mg, Sugar 5.7 g

LIGHT & CRISPY VEGAN WAFFLES



Light & Crispy Vegan Waffles image

The best vegan waffle I've had. Golden-brown, crispy, light, tender, full of flavor (especially with those appealing vanilla bean flecks). Plus, only 6 ingredients and 1 bowl!

Provided by Kare for Kitchen Treaty

Time 20m

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 14-ounce can full-fat coconut milk (about 1 3/4 cups)
1 vanilla bean
1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
1/3 cup granulated sugar
2 teaspoons baking powder
1/4 teaspoon salt (I like fine-grain sea salt for this recipe)
Your favorite cooking spray (if needed (I have a non-stick waffle maker so I don't need or use any spray))
Pure maple syrup
Butter (or vegan butter)
Fresh berries

Steps:

  • Preheat your waffle maker.
  • If the coconut milk is solidified, place it into a small saucepan and set over low heat. Heat just until liquid, but not warm.
  • Pour coconut milk into a large mixing bowl. Scrape the pulp of the vanilla bean into the coconut milk (discard the pod) or add vanilla bean paste or extract. Stir to combine.
  • Add the fl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t. Stir gently with a wooden spoon just until combined (if you overmix, you risk making the waffles tough; don't worry, a few lumps are okay).
  • Spray your preheated waffle maker with cooking spray, if using. Pour batter into your waffle maker according to manufacturer instructions, as waffle makers vary. My waffle maker takes a heaping 1/3 cup per side.
  • Cook until golden brown, as per your individual waffle maker.
  • Serve with pure maple syrup, butter (or vegan butter), fresh berries, or anything else you'd like!

Nutrition Facts : ServingSize 2 waffles, Calories 325 kcal, Sugar 23 g, Sodium 241 mg, Fat 3 g, SaturatedFat 1 g, Carbohydrate 67 g, Fiber 2 g, Protein 6 g

COCONUT WAFFLES



Coconut Waffles image

So tender they almost melt in your mouth, these waffles have a hint of coconut flavor in every bite. We like to top the golden stack with whipped cream and a drizzle of chocolate sauce for an indulgent morning treat.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Breakfast     Brunch

Time 20m

Yield 8 waffles.

Number Of Ingredients 10

1-3/4 cups all-purpose flour
2 tablespoons sugar
1 tablespoon baking powder
Dash salt
3 eggs
1 can (13.66 ounces) coconut milk
6 tablespoons butter, melted
1/8 teaspoon coconut extract
3/4 cup sweetened shredded coconut
Chocolate ice cream topping and whipped cream

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ine the flour, sugar, baking powder and salt. In another bowl, whisk the eggs, coconut milk, butter and extract. Stir into dry ingredients just until moistened. Fold in coconut., Bake in a preheated waffle iron according to manufacturer's directions until golden brown. Serve desired amount of waffles with whipped cream and chocolate topping., To freeze waffles, arrange waffles in a single layer on baking sheets. Freeze overnight or until firm. Transfer to a resealable plastic freezer bag. Waffles may be frozen for up to 2 months., To use frozen waffles: Reheat waffles in a toaster. , Serve with chocolate topping and whipped cream.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 706 calories, Fat 48g fat (36g saturated fat), Cholesterol 204mg cholesterol, Sodium 569mg sodium, Carbohydrate 59g carbohydrate (13g sugars, Fiber 3g fiber), Protein 13g protein.
